Output b94f3d05a7decdbdc65500c2188870603c3ded8b786efce50583f2beb8b4b9af:3

value
156835176
script pubkey
OP_0 OP_PUSHBYTES_20 b5c040e02bb15a4bc37c830b3ec49430b64f205a
address
bc1qkhqypcptk9dyhsmusv9na3y5xzmy7gz6l8xrsr
transaction
b94f3d05a7decdbdc65500c2188870603c3ded8b786efce50583f2beb8b4b9af
confirmations
233652
spent
true